Business Book Giveaway: EcoCommerce 101: Adding an ecological dimension to the economy

EcoCommerce 101: Adding an ecological dimension to the economy

According to Gieseke, “EcoCommerce . . . provides the framework to build an ecological intelligence system that allows the public arena of commerce to define sustainability.”

Gieseke shows us that economic development and bio-ecological preservation are more inherently connected than you might think, and that the  two goals can be met (and, in fact, are one and the same) with coordinated effort and a renewed dedication to seeing economy and ecology through the same lens.

Gieseke points out that “sustainability” is defined by us, the participants in the economy. EcoCommerce 101 is a roadmap for reshaping the market to support a sustainable future we can all be proud of.

John Bradberry, 6 Secrets to Startup Success: How to Turn Your Entrepreneurial Passion Into a Thriving Business

In 2007, Bradberry noticed a disturbing trend among business startups and set out to investigate why so many of them fail despite their investors and talented leadership. He designed a study so that he could isolate the differences between the successful companies he has started or invested in and companies that plummet shortly after opening their doors.

What he found was shocking—a surprising amount of entrepreneurs, Bradberry found, seem to let their passions lead them to jump feet-first into their business before they’ve done appropriate research or come up with a thoughtful plan for moving forward. The notion of having a plan when starting anything from scratch is standard procedure for many projects: building a house, renovating a deck, planting a garden, training a puppy—why should that crucial step of preparation and planning be left out of the equation entirely with something as important as starting a business?
